Toscana Aeroporti: minority share acquired from the UAE fund

Base for future cooperation in airport investments

The sovereign fund of Dubai managed by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ktum -the first minister of the United Arab Emirates and governor of the capital's region- has acquired a significant part of the shares of Toscana Aeroporti -the company that manages the airports of Pisa and Florence.
